KVUE-TV improves news graphics workflow
KVUE-TV, the Belo-owned station in Austin, TX, has revamped its news graphics workflow, and is simultaneously preparing for an HD future.
The station has begun using the Pixel Power Clarity 5000 as its primary still store and animation source for all of its newscasts. Integration with the Avid Technology iNews system lets producers assemble simple graphics using available elements and gives the station’s news department greater control over its editorial product.
According to KVUE-TV on-air operations manager Gerry Marcelo, the system has changed the entire workflow of graphics development, and has allowed the graphics staff to focus more on design and less on “one-shot, disposable” graphics.
The HD support that the system offers gives the station’s news operations a foundation for future HD production and on-air capabilities, he added.
Clarity 5000 runs the latest Clarity Version 7 software, which includes clip capability, perspective DVE, timeline animation and real-time 3-D options.
